History of Forest School in Shropshire

pictures of children at forest school

Shropshire Council has been nurturing Forest School in the county since 2002. This is when a steering group formed, with representatives from the former Shropshire County Council's Early Years and Childcare team, local woodland owners and environmental educators. Since then, this group has become registered as a Forest Education Initiative Cluster Group and this organisation has been instrumental in developing a Forest School network across England.

The Shropshire Early Years Development Childcare Partnership (EYDCP) provided funding for a two year pilot project. This involved establishing an exemplar Shropshire County Council Forest School site, to the south of Shrewsbury, and delivering Forest School sessions to local schools and settings. A Forest School co-ordinator was employed with two Forest School leaders to deliver sessions at the exemplar site.

Due to the success of this pilot project, Shropshire Council has now employed a permanent Forest School Development Officer who works with a team of Forest School Leaders delivering Forest School sessions at exemplar sites in Shropshire.

Shropshire Council delivers OCN Forest School Training.
